Herbaceous Profiles

Herbaceous profiles describe cannabis cultivars that express leafy, green-plant aromatics rather than fruity, floral, or heavily resinous notes. These strains often carry terpene signatures dominated by compounds like myrcene, pinene, and limonene in combinations that create fresh, vegetative, or hay-like scent characteristics. Herbaceous genetics are frequently observed in landrace and heirloom lines, as well as in modern cultivars bred for cannabinoid potency where terpene diversity was not the primary selection pressure. Breeders working with herbaceous profiles often trace lineage to equatorial or subtropical origins, where plant survival favored robust, vigorous growth over volatile aromatic defense compounds. Understanding herbaceous profiles is essential for genetic preservation efforts and for breeding programs seeking to restore terpene complexity in high-potency lines.

Breeder relevance

Breeders select for or against herbaceous traits depending on target market and genetic goals. Herbaceous parent plants are valuable for introducing vigor and stability into unstable or difficult-to-cultivate lines.
